About JiBe
JiBe is a cloud based fully integrated ERP system for the shipping industry. Our goal is to allow shipping companies to improve productivity, efficiency and safety levels, while reducing costs. JiBe ERP enables increased automation and streamlining of processes, creating pre-defined work flows and reducing the usage of email and paper.
Job Responsibilities
- Drive the execution of all product lifecycle processes for JiBe ERP products, including product research, market research, competitive analysis, planning, positioning, roadmap development, requirements development, and product launch
- Translate product strategy into detailed requirements for prototype construction and final product development by engineering teams.
- Create product strategy documents that describe business cases, high-level use cases, technical requirements, and other relevant artifacts.
- Collaborate closely with software engineering, product marketing, and sales teams on the development, QA, and release of products and balance of resources to ensure success for the entire organization.
- Become an expert of your designated modules and serve as a knowledge source, including best practices and regulatory requirements.
- Establish a shared vision by building alignment on priorities leading to product execution.
- Leverage user research, usability studies, market research, experiments and data analysis and translate them into requirements that solve real problems for a large set of users.
- Ensure that product decisions are based on strong logical rigor and in-depth analysis, and value data over opinions
- Expected to develop a deep understanding of our users: their problems, and their needs
